None of my mixed media paintings begin with any sense of a finished picture in my mind. Each one takes on a life of its own as I play around with papers and paint and do my best to listen to what I sense God might be saying to me. This process is so fascinating to me both in terms of the creative abandon it gives me and the spiritual encouragement I end up taking away.

In this piece, I see a vibrant and colourful Holy Spirit reminder to my heart that He is the God of the new thing! Just as with His children of Israel, He hears our cries too and is at work even when we may not perceive anything to be happening. Creation testifies to this. Like when a seed is planted and life begins at first in a dark, hidden place but then breaks new ground and becomes a beautiful flower with leaves and petals and fragrance! Or like the butterfly, for whom life begins as something that crawls along the ground and leads to a juncture of crisis and into a staggering process of transformation, after which, come wings and flight and nectar!! – an outcome unfathomable to a caterpillar!! Even when we don't see it God is working. Even when we don’t feel it God is working.

He is able to do immeasurably more than I can get my head around. His ways are not my ways. Is anything too hard for Him? Fresh encouragement to trust, leaning not on my own understanding, and see what the 'I AM' God of wonders will do next!

This is a high resolution scan & exhibition quality digital print of my original artwork using Epson UltraChrome HD inks on lovely quality fine art inkjet paper.

Printed image sizes:

A3 = 280x380mm printed on A3 paper (Fit Ikea frames 40x50cm with mount)

A4 = 195x284mm printed on A4 paper (Fit Ikea frames 30x40cm with mount)

A5 = 127x177.8mm (5x7") printed on A5 paper (Fit 5x7" frames or Ikea frames 18x24cm with mount)

Your print comes unmounted and unframed.

All prints are carefully packaged with a backboard for support and sealed in a clear cellophane sleeve embellished in the top right corner with a little 'Rara Makes' label.

All prints are shipped in strong cardboard envelopes.
